SH101M025ST Equivalent & Substitute Parts
Part Overview
The SH101M025ST is a 100 µF, 25 V aluminum electrolytic capacitor in radial, can package manufactured by Cornell Dubilier Electronics (CDE). This component is classified as obsolete, making equivalent and substitute parts necessary for ongoing production and maintenance applications. The part operates across a temperature range of -40°C to 105°C with a rated lifetime of 2000 hours at 105°C, suitable for general-purpose applications requiring stable capacitance and low equivalent series resistance.

Substitute Part Grouping Explanation
Substitution of the SH101M025ST is determined by strict equivalence across the following critical parameters:
Mandatory Matching Parameters:
- Capacitance: 100 µF (exact match required)
- Voltage Rating: 25 V (exact match required)
- Tolerance: ±20% (exact match required)
- Polarization: Polar (exact match required)
- Mounting Type: Through Hole (exact match required)
- Package Type: Radial, Can (exact match required)
- Lead Spacing: 0.098" (2.50 mm) (exact match required)
Compatible Parameter Ranges:
- Operating Temperature Range: Must encompass or equal -40°C to 105°C minimum
- Lifetime @ 105°C: Must meet or exceed 2000 hours
- ESR @ 120 Hz: Must not exceed 2.12 Ohm (lower values acceptable)
- Ripple Current @ 120 Hz: Must meet or exceed 145 mA
- Ripple Current @ 10 kHz: Must meet or exceed 174 mA
- Case Diameter: Tolerance of ±0.012" (0.30 mm) acceptable for mechanical fit
- Height (Seated Max): Tolerance of ±0.079" (2.00 mm) acceptable for board clearance
Substitute parts are classified as either Upgrade (enhanced performance or active product status) or Direct (equivalent performance, may be obsolete).

Engineering Selection Recommendations
Upgrade Parts (Active Product Status):
SEK101M025ST (Mallory) is an active upgrade substitute with identical electrical specifications to the main part. This part maintains the same ESR of 2.12 Ohm @ 120 Hz and lifetime rating of 2000 hours @ 105°C. The operating temperature range extends to -55°C, providing enhanced low-temperature performance. Height increases to 0.512" (13.00 mm), requiring verification of board clearance. This part is ROHS3 compliant with unlimited moisture sensitivity rating.
EKZE250ELL101MF11D (Chemi-Con) is an active direct substitute with enhanced ripple current handling at high frequencies (405 mA @ 100 kHz). Lifetime rating matches the main part at 2000 hours @ 105°C. Operating temperature range is -40°C to 105°C. This part is ROHS3 compliant and suitable for applications requiring higher ripple current capacity.
EEU-EB1E101S (Panasonic Electronic Components) is an active upgrade substitute with extended lifetime of 5000 hours @ 105°C, providing superior reliability for long-term applications. Operating temperature range is -40°C to 105°C. Height is 0.480" (12.20 mm). Ripple current at 120 Hz is 95 mA, which is below the main part specification of 145 mA; this part is suitable only for applications with lower ripple current requirements. ROHS3 compliant.
Direct Equivalent Parts (Obsolete Status):
517D107M025AA6AE3 (Vishay Sprague) is an obsolete direct substitute with identical mechanical dimensions and lead spacing. Ripple current at 10 kHz is 217.5 mA, exceeding the main part specification. Operating temperature range extends to -55°C. ROHS3 compliant.
UHE1E101MED (Nichicon) is an obsolete direct substitute with extended lifetime of 5000 hours @ 105°C. Ripple current performance exceeds specifications at both 120 Hz (238 mA) and 100 kHz (340 mA). Operating temperature range is -40°C to 105°C. ROHS3 compliant. This part offers superior performance characteristics for demanding applications.
Selection Criteria:
For new designs and long-term production, select from active parts: SEK101M025ST, EKZE250ELL101MF11D, or EEU-EB1E101S. Verify board clearance for SEK101M025ST due to increased height. For applications requiring lower ripple current, avoid EEU-EB1E101S. For applications requiring extended lifetime and enhanced ripple current handling, select UHE1E101MED or EKZE250ELL101MF11D, noting that UHE1E101MED is obsolete.
Frequently Asked Questions (FAQ)
Q: Can SEK101M025ST be used as a direct replacement for SH101M025ST?
A: SEK101M025ST is electrically equivalent with identical capacitance, voltage rating, tolerance, and ESR specifications. However, the height increases from 0.433" to 0.512" (11.00 mm to 13.00 mm). Board clearance must be verified before substitution. All other mechanical and electrical parameters are compatible.
Q: What is the difference between "Upgrade" and "Direct" substitute classifications?
A: Upgrade parts have active product status and may include enhanced performance characteristics such as extended lifetime or improved ripple current handling. Direct substitutes provide equivalent performance to the main part and may be obsolete. Both classifications indicate electrical and mechanical compatibility.
Q: Why does EEU-EB1E101S show lower ripple current at 120 Hz compared to the main part?
A: EEU-EB1E101S is rated for 95 mA @ 120 Hz, below the main part specification of 145 mA. This part is suitable only for applications with ripple current requirements at or below 95 mA @ 120 Hz. For applications requiring the full 145 mA ripple current capacity, select alternative substitutes.
Q: Are all substitute parts ROHS3 compliant?
A: All substitute parts listed are ROHS3 compliant, matching the compliance status of the main part SH101M025ST.
Q: What is the significance of the 5000-hour lifetime rating in UHE1E101MED and EEU-EB1E101S?
A: These parts are rated for 5000 hours @ 105°C, compared to 2000 hours for the main part and most other substitutes. Extended lifetime indicates longer operational reliability in high-temperature environments and is suitable for applications requiring extended service life.
Q: Can the case diameter increase from 0.236" to 0.248" affect board layout?
A: The case diameter increase of 0.012" (0.30 mm) is within acceptable mechanical tolerance for radial can packages. However, board layout with tight component spacing should be reviewed to ensure adequate clearance around the capacitor body.
Q: Which substitute part offers the best overall performance?
A: Performance selection depends on application requirements. UHE1E101MED and EKZE250ELL101MF11D offer the highest ripple current capacity. EEU-EB1E101S and UHE1E101MED provide extended 5000-hour lifetime. For active product status with standard performance, SEK101M025ST is recommended.
Q: Is operating temperature range expansion from -40°C to -55°C significant?
A: Operating temperature range expansion to -55°C provides enhanced performance in cold environments. For applications operating only within -40°C to 105°C, this expansion is not required. For applications requiring operation below -40°C, select SEK101M025ST or 517D107M025AA6AE3.
Q: What packaging formats are available for these substitute parts?
A: All substitute parts are supplied in Through Hole radial can packages with 0.098" (2.50 mm) lead spacing. Packaging formats vary by supplier: SEK101M025ST is supplied in Box format, while 517D107M025AA6AE3, EKZE250ELL101MF11D, UHE1E101MED, and EEU-EB1E101S are supplied in Bulk format.
